  在竞争日渐激烈的求职市场,求职者们都使尽浑身解数,想通过自己的聪明才智、专业技能得到HR的青睐。但是,要想在求职中脱颖而出,我们除了要有IQ这一硬件,还得有软件——职场EQ。职场EQ是指一个人掌控自己和他人情绪的能力在职场和工作中的具体表现,更加侧重对自己和他人的工作情绪的了解和把握,以及如何处理好职场中的人际关系,是职业化的情绪能力的表现。
  Simone: Hey, Ludwig. How’s it been going lately?
  Ludwig: Oh, hello there, Simone. Things have been excellent lately. Perfect. I’ve never been better. ①I’m walking on sunshine.
  Simone: Really? Something tells me you’re being less than honest.
  Ludwig: Rats! You’re right. Things haven’t been going well at all lately. ②What gave me away?
  Simone: The eyes are the window to the soul, you know, and your eyes weren’t smiling.
  Ludwig: I guess I can’t hide anything from the likes of you! How did you get such a high EQ, anyway?
  Simone: I guess I’ve always just had a 1)knack for reading people. You have no need to be jealous, though; your IQ is so high it’s scary.
  Ludwig: Well, thanks! ③However, my IQ hasn’t been pulling its own weight lately. No matter how smart I make myself look in job interviews, I can never land the job.
  Simone: Ah, finally we get to the heart of the matter! You’re having trouble getting a job and you don’t know why.
  Ludwig: ④Exactly! I go into every interview with guns 2)blazing. I always make sure they know I’m smarter than them, and yet they never seem to get it.
  Simone: I think I know what the problem is.
  Ludwig: How could you possibly know what the problem is? No 3)offense, but like you said earlier, I’m on another level in terms of IQ. If I can’t figure it out, I’m sure you can’t either.
  Simone: See? That’s exactly the problem. ⑤You’re trying to cash in on your IQ, but what you don’t realize is that EQ is just as important for landing a job.
  Ludwig: But I’m an engineer, not a 4)psychiatrist. EQ doesn’t help me design a better machine.
  Simone: ⑥But you won’t be working in a 5)vacuum. No matter what you do for a living, you do it with other people, and working well with them is important.
  Ludwig: I hadn’t thought about it that way.
  Simone: To them, you’re just a fresh graduate with no experience. ⑦No matter how smart you are, if you think you already know everything, you’ll never grow into the job, and you’ll never learn to fit in with the rest of the team.
  Ludwig: Your logic is sound. I admit my error. So how can I make them think I have sufficient EQ?
  Simone: That was a pretty quick about-face. Well, the best way to convince you have a high EQ is to actually develop a high EQ. ⑧Spend more time listening to others, observing people, trying to imagine walking a mile in someone else’s shoes.   Ludwig: I don’t have time for that much self-improvement. I need a quick fix, or I’ll be out of money before I get a job. Simone: Well, in that case, try acting more human in the interview. Make yourself look smart, but also humble. Try to connect with them as people, not just as engineers. Try to have a bit of the human touch.
  Ludwig: That sounds challenging.
  Simone: I’m sure your IQ is up to the task!
  Ludwig: Well, intelligence isn’t everything, you know.
  Simone: Now you’ve got it!

  Smart Sentences
  ① I’m walking on sunshine. 我正春风得意呢。
  walk on sunshine: very cheerful(非常快乐)。例如:
  Ever since she met John, Sally has been walking on sunshine.
  萨莉自从认识约翰后,一直都非常开心。
  ② What gave me away? 是什么出卖了我?
  give sb. away: reveal a secret about sb.(泄露某人的秘密,出卖某人)。例如:
  Please don’t give me away. I don’t want anyone to know my plans yet.
  千万别把我的事说漏了,我现在还不想让别人知道我的计划。
  ③ However, my IQ hasn’t been pulling its own weight lately. 但是,我的智商最近都没有发挥出来。
  pull sb.’s own weight: do one’s own share, as of work (用以指做好自己的本职工作)。例如:
  If everyone pulls his or her own weight, we should finish the project before the deadline.
  如果人人都做好自己的本份,我们会在截止时间前完成这个项目。
  ④ Exactly! I go into every interview with guns blazing. 的确!我总是全力以赴地参加每个面试。   with guns blazing: do sth. aggressively(积极地做某事)。例如:
  The management team took action immediately, with guns blazing, and finally, the rumors went away.
  管理层迅速积极采取行动,最终谣言消失了。
  ⑤ You’re trying to cash in on your IQ, but what you don’t realize is that EQ is just as important for landing a job. 你想尽量利用你的智商,但是你没意识到情商对于找工作也同样很重要。
  cash in on sth.: take advantage of sth.(利用某事)例如: We should cash in on the early arrival of winter this year and unveil our latest winter fashion.
  我们应该利用今年早冬这个机会,及早推出我们最新的冬季时装。
  ⑥ But you won’t be working in a vacuum. 但是你不能在真空中工作。
  in a vacuum: not affected by any outside influences or information(似在真空中,脱离实际)。例如:
  These kids are growing up in a vacuum, they know nothing about the real world besides their school work.
  这些孩子在真空里长大,除了学业,对现实世界一点儿都不了解。
  ⑦ No matter how smart you are, if you think you already know everything, you’ll never grow into the job, and you’ll never learn to fit in with the rest of the team. 不管你有多么聪明,如果你认为自己已经了解了一切,你就不能在工作中成熟起来,那么你就不会学会和团队的其他人合得来。
  grow into sth.: develop or change so as to fit sth.(变得适合于……,逐渐适应)。例如:
  Straightforward and simple, Wendy never grew into the women’s club of graceful ladies.
  温迪粗犷、简单,一直都无法适应那个由淑女组成的女性俱乐部。
  ⑧ Spend more time listening to others, observing people, trying to imagine walking a mile in someone else’s shoes. 花更多的时间聆听他人的想法,观察他人的举动,尝试站在他人的立场上想问题。
  walk a mile in sb. else’s shoes: actually do what others do(做他人做的事情)。例如:
  If you could walk a mile in her shoes, you would understand why she doesn’t want to work under Mrs. Black.
  如果你也处于她的位置,你就明白她为什么不想在布莱克夫人手下工作了。
